본문 바로가기
반응형

3. 웹개발/3_3 AWS11

[AWS] 10-1.EC2 MySQL 설치 [AWS] 10-1.EC2 MySql 설치 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 [AWS] EC2에 MySql 설치하기 ] 입니다. : ) 1. MySql 직접 설치 1. 설치 가능 여부 확인 sudo yum list mysql* - yum list를 확인해보니 mysql server가 존재하지 않는다. 분명히 예전엔 yum 을 통해 설치가 가능했었던 것 같은데, 다른 방법을 통해 설치. - 편의상 루트 계정으로 전환하여 설치 시작. sudo su 2. 최신 버전 MySql 다운로드 및 설치 - 현재 시점에서, 최신 mysql 버전 확인 https://dev.mysql.com/downloads/repo/yum/ - 다음 명령어로 현재 나의 linux 환경에 맞는 버전 다운로드 및 설치 wget .. 2021. 8. 24.
[AWS] 9-2.EC2 SSH 무작위 로그인 시도 막기(무차별 대입 공격 방어) [AWS] 9-2.EC2 SSH 무작위 로그인 시도 막기(무차별 대입 공격 방어) 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 [AWS] EC2 SSH 무차별 대입 공격 방어 ] 입니다. : ) 0.들어가기 앞서 1. 이전 포스팅에서 특수한 목적 으로 인해 공개키 없이 ssh접속 가능하도록 설정 하였었다. - 사실 이는 매우 위험한 일이며 이로인해 본인의 SSH 접속인증이 뚫릴수 있는 가능성을 열어 둔 것과 같다. - Linux 서버를 공개망에서 사용하면서 방화벽을 사용하지 않는 경우 ssh 로그인을 지속적으로 시도하는 ip, 로그를 볼 수 있는데, 이는 무차별 대입 공격을 받고 있일 확률이 크다. 대부분 외국 IP 대역에서 지속적으로 ssh 로그인을 시도하는데 무작위 비밀번호를 대입하여 공격을 하고 .. 2020. 9. 13.
[AWS] 9.AWS EC2 pem키 없이 접속 가능하도록 설정하기 [AWS] 9.AWS EC2 pem키 없이 접속 가능하도록 설정하기(AWS EC2 비밀번호로 접속 하기) 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 [AWS] EC2 비밀번호로 접속 설정 하기 ] 입니다. : ) 0.기존 User로 접속하여 신규 User 생성하기 1. 외부 ftp 오픈시 기본적인 KeyPair를 사용하지 않고 접속 허용하도록 해야하는 경우가 생겼다. - EC2는 기본적으로 머신 생성시 발급한 공개키로만 접근하도록 설정 되어있다. 이 방법이 가장 뛰어난 보안성을 제공하지만 특수한 상황 또는 고객의 요구 사항에 따라 Password Access가 필요한 상황도 있다. - 이럴때 이번엔 기존 User는 그대로 사용하고, 신규 유저를 생성하여 공개키 없이 접속 가능하도록 만들어 보자. 2... 2020. 8. 31.
[AWS] 8.AWS EC2 root 계정 활성화 시키기 [AWS] 8.AWS EC2 root 계정 활성화 시키기 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 AWS EC2 (리눅스) root 계정 사용하기 ] 입니다. : ) 이전 포스팅을 통해 EC2 리눅스를 설치 해보았다. 다만 root 권한이 필요 한 경우도 있지만, 기본적으로 aws에서 제공하는 AMI로 리눅스를 설치한 경우 해당 계정 접속이 막혀있다. AWS EC2 에서도 root 계정을 사용할 수 있고, 해당 방법에 대해 알아보자. Elastic IP 설정 ▶ 1. root 비밀번호를 먼저 변경하여 준다. #sudo passwd root ▶ 2. sshd_config 설정정보 변경 #sudo vi /etc/ssh/sshd_config :set nu 를 입력하여 보기 좋게 라인수 표시. 38 라인의.. 2019. 10. 5.
[AWS] 7.AWS Elastic IP (EIP) 고정 아이피 할당 하기 [AWS] 7.AWS Elastic IP (EIP) 고정 아이피 할당 하기 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 AWS Elastic IP 설정 ] 입니다. : ) 이전 포스팅에서 생성한 [WordPress Instance를 사용하여 실습] 을 해보았다. ※ Elastic IP (EIP) 고정 아이피 할당 하기 앞서 EC2 인스턴스의 Pubic IP 를 통해 해당 인스턴스에 접속 가능 하였다. 하지만, 인스턴스의 Public IP는 고정된 IP 주소가 아니라 유동적인 IP 주소 이다. EC2 인스턴스를 STOP, 재시작 하게 되면 IP 주소가 바뀐다. 그렇기 떄문에 해당 유동 IP로는 실제 서비스로 사용하긴 어렵다고 볼 수있다. 안정적으로 서비스를 운영 하기 위해서는 당연히 고정 IP가 필요하다.. 2019. 9. 22.
[AWS] 6.EC2 AWS MarketPlace 사용방법 (EX. WordPress 설치) [AWS] 6.AWS MarketPlace 사용방법 (EX. WordPress 설치) 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 AWS 마켓플레이스 사용 방법 & WordPress 설치방법 ] 입니다. : ) 이전 포스팅에서 [EC2 리눅스 인스턴스 설치(AWS 기본 제공 이미지), 접속] 을 해보았다. 이와 비슷한 내용이지만 MarketPlace를 이용하여 AWS를 설치해보려 한다. ※ AWS MarketPlace - App Store 와 같은 경우와 같이 다른사람이 만든 프로그램을 설치해서 사용하는 것. WordPress든 아파치를 통한 웹서버를 하나 띄우는 작업이든 초기에 해야 해줘야 할 일들이 무척 많다. 서버 작업이 익숙하지 않던 난 TomCat & Apache를 띄우는데만 꽤 오랜 시간이 .. 2019. 3. 2.
[AWS] 5.EC2 리눅스 인스턴스 접속 방법 [AWS] 5.EC2 리눅스 인스턴스 접속 방법 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 EC2 리눅스 인스턴스 접속하기 ] 입니다. : ) 이전 포스팅에서 [EC2 리눅스 인스턴스 설치]를 완료 하였다. 이제 해당 인스턴스에 어떻게 접속하는지 포스팅 하려 한다. ※ 리눅스는 SSH라고 하는 방식을 통해 원격제어를 한다. - 윈도우는 SSH가 없기 때문에 ssh역할을 해줄 수 있는 프로그램을 설치해 줘야한다. -이 중 무료이면서 가장 대표인 것이 putty이다. - 상세 설명을 보려면 다음과 같이 Instance 설정 화면에서 우클릭, [연결] 클릭 시 볼 수 있다. - 연결 방식은 [독립 실행형 SSH 클라이언트] 를 선택 하여 준다. - 지금 부터 2가지 방법으로 원격으로 접속하는 방법을 작성하.. 2019. 2. 7.
[AWS] 4.EC2(Elastic Compute Cloud) 란? (설치 포함) [AWS] 4.EC2(Elastic Compute Cloud) 시작하기 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 Elastic Compute Cloud(EC2) 란? ] 입니다. : ) AWS 기초 수업 중 2교시에서는 역시 가장 기본이 되는 [EC2] 에 관한 내용이 주를 이루었다. EC2를 나름 더 이해 하고, 실습까지 해볼수 있도록 포스팅 해보아야 겠다. 시작하기 앞서 혹시 시간이 없으신 분들은 그림만 보고 빠르게 세팅 하셔도 됩니다...ㅠㅠ 스크롤이 생각보다 기네요. Amazon Elastic Compute Cloud (EC2) ▶ 독립된 컴퓨터를 임대해주는 서비스 (AWS의 대표적인 서비스, 대표적인 상품) 1. 특징 - 컴퓨팅 요구사항의 변화에 따라 컴퓨팅 파워를 조정할 수 있다. - 새.. 2019. 2. 5.
[AWS] 3.리전(지역)과 가용영역(Availability Zone) [AWS] 3.리전(지역)과 가용영역(Availability Zone) 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 AWS 리전과 가용영역 ] 입니다. : ) 얼마전 회사에서 AWS 교육지원을 해주기에 다녀왔다. 1교시(총 4교시) 내용 중 [리전], [가용영역]에 대해 설명을 들었지만 솔직히 그자리에선 제대로 이해가 되지 않았다. 그래서 다시 한번 정리해보다보니, 생각보다 어떤 측면에선 중요한 것 같아 따로 포스팅 주제로 빼보았다. 리전(지역) ▶ 말 그대로 지리적 위치를 말한다. - 아마존 웹 서비스들의 서버가 어디에 위치 하는가? ▶ 내가 서비스 하려는 지역의 주 고객들이 거주하는 지역과 서버의 거리가 멀면 멀수록 느려진다. - 웹 사이트를 운영한다고 하면 내 싸이트를 이용하는 고객이 어디에 위치.. 2019. 2. 5.
[AWS] 2.AWS 회원가입 따라하기 [AWS] 2.AWS 회원가입 따라하기 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 AWS 회원가입 방법] 입니다. : ) AWS를 글로만 배우면 다 이해가 되지 않을 것이다. 직업 회원 가입하고, 실습해보면 이해하면 된다. 무료 (프리티어) 서비스 이용이 가능하기 때문이다. 하지만 모든게 다 무료는 아니다. 특정 사양 대상이며, 1년간 무료이지만 특정 구간, 사용량을 넘어가면 과금 될 수 있다.AWS 회원가입 - 다음 싸이트로 이동 한다.https://portal.aws.amazon.com/billing/signup#/start - 12개월 프리 티어 엑세스 포함. 어쩌고로 시작하는 페이지를 볼 수 있다. - 여기까지 일반 싸이트 회원가입과 별 다를바 없다. - 계정 유형은 [ 개인 ] 을 선택 하여.. 2019. 2. 4.
[AWS] 1.AWS란? [AWS] 1.AWS란? 안녕하세요. 갓대희 입니다. 이번 포스팅은 [ AWS(Amazon Web Service) ] 입니다. : ) 얼마전 회사에서 AWS 교육지원을 해주기에 다녀왔다. 그중 가장 기초 부분만 먼저 정리해서 올려 보도록 해야겠다. (정확히 기초 교육 총 4교시중 1교시 내용 정리) AWS? - 아마존닷컴에서 개발한 클라우드 컴퓨팅 플랫폼이다. - Amazon Web Services는 아마존(Amazon)에서 제공하는 클라우드 서비스로, 네트워킹을 기반으로 가상 컴퓨터와 스토리지, 네트워크 인프라 등 다양한 서비스를 제공하고 있다. - 비즈니스와 개발자가 웹 서비스를 사용하여 확장 가능하고 정교한 애플리케이션 구축하도록 지원하여 준다. - 현재 소규모 법인(회사) 및 개인 을 포함한 다양.. 2019. 2. 4.
반응형